Taxonomic Classification

Rank Babington's Orache Brownfish
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Echinodermata (Echinoderms)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Holothuroidea (Holothuroidea)
Order Caryophyllales (Caryophyllales) Holothuriida (Holothuriida)
Family Amaranthaceae Holothuriidae
Genus Atriplex Actinopyga
Species Atriplex glabriuscula Actinopyga echinites
